Thomas Moore
born 1780, died 1852

 

 



War Against Babylon

"War against Babylon!" shout we around,
Be our banners through earth unfurl'd;
Rise up, ye nations, ye kings, at the sound -
"War against Babylon!" shout through the world!
Oh thou, that dwellest on many waters,
Thy day of pride is ended now;
And the dark curse of Israel's daughters
Breaks, like a thunder-cloud, over thy brow!
War, war, war against Babylon!

Make bright the arrows, and gather the shields,
Set the standard of God on high;
Swarm we, like locusts, o'er all her fields,
"Zion" our watchword, and "vengeance" our cry!
Woe! woe! - the time of thy visitation
Is come, proud Land, thy doom is cast -
And the black surge of desolation
Sweeps o'er thy guilty head, at last!
War, war, war against Babylon!
